Показать сообщение отдельно
  #13 (permalink)  
Старый 14.07.2016, 18:04
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,127

Benos,
// обнуляем временный массив с суммой
function cleanTotal(){
    itemDataSum = [];
}

// суммируем данные
function addSum(item, itemArray){
    if(!('total' in Data)){
          Data["total"] = {};
          Data["total"].name = "Всего";
    }
    for(var i = 0; i < itemArray.length; i++){
        itemDataSum[i] = (+itemDataSum[i]||0) + +itemArray[i];
    }
    Data["total"][item] = itemDataSum;
}
Ответить с цитированием